Factors Affecting Cost
- Type of Service: Routine maintenance is generally less expensive than emergency repairs.
- Complexity of the Job: More complex issues require more time and specialized skills, increasing costs.
- Materials Used: High-quality materials will cost more but may offer better longevity.
- Labor Rates: Labor costs can vary depending on the plumber's experience and the time of day.
- Location of the Problem: Hard-to-reach areas may result in higher labor costs.
- Permits and Inspections: Some jobs may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all cost.
- Urgency: Emergency services often come with a premium charge.
Common Tasks and Costs
| Task | Average Cost (Woodinville, WA) |
|---|---|
| Fixing a Leaky Faucet | $75 - $150 |
| Installing a New Toilet | $200 - $400 |
| Water Heater Installation | $800 - $1,500 |
| Drain Cleaning | $100 - $250 |
| Pipe Replacement (per foot) | $50 - $100 |
| Garbage Disposal Installation | $150 - $300 |
| Sewer Line Repair | $3,000 - $7,000 |
| Sump Pump Installation | $1,000 - $2,500 |
